Building Trust: Insights from Darryl Stickel

Episode Overview

  • Trust-building requires vulnerability and self-trust.
  • Effective communication is crucial in fostering trust.
  • Parenting involves allowing children to make mistakes.
  • Integrity plays a significant role in trust-building.
  • Awareness helps nurture deeper relationships.
Trust requires us to be vulnerable, but with self-trust, we can navigate the uncertainties of any relationship.
In the latest episode of the Addict to Athlete Podcast, Coach Blu Robinson delves into the intricate dynamics of trust-building with Darryl Stickel, a renowned expert in the field. The conversation centers around the vital components of trust, including vulnerability, self-trust, and effective communication. Darryl Stickel shares personal anecdotes that shed light on how his upbringing in a small, isolated Canadian town influenced his understanding of trust.
He emphasizes that trust is a journey, one that requires individuals to be open to vulnerability while maintaining self-trust. In early relationships, uncertainty often dominates, necessitating a cautious approach to vulnerability. Darryl warns against impulsively pulling all trust levers simultaneously, as it may lead to challenging situations. The discussion transitions into practical strategies for fostering trust within various relationships, notably in parenting.
Coach Blu Robinson echoes the sentiment that allowing children to make mistakes is crucial for their growth, as it teaches them resilience and accountability. He underscores the importance of parenting from a place of patience rather than inconvenience, advocating for a supportive approach that encourages self-discovery. The episode also highlights the significance of communication and integrity in trust-building. Darryl asserts that understanding one's audience and prioritizing their needs demonstrates benevolence and integrity.
By role-modeling these values, individuals can strengthen their ability to build and maintain trust. Listeners are encouraged to integrate these insights into their personal and professional relationships, fostering environments where trust can flourish. Coach Blu Robinson and Darryl Stickel leave audiences with a sense of hope and motivation, inspiring them to embark on their own trust-building journeys.
